Tenet Fintech Group Inc. (OTCMKTS:PKKFF) Short Interest Down 98.5% in April

Tenet Fintech Group Inc. (OTCMKTS:PKKFFG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large drop in short interest during the month of April. As of April 30th, there was short interest totaling 206 shares, a drop of 98.5% from the April 15th total of 13,972 shares. Currently, 0.0% of the company’s stock are sold short.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 238,084 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.0 days.

Tenet Fintech Group Stock Performance

Shares of OTCMKTS PKKFF traded up $0.00 during midday trading on Tuesday, reaching $0.06. The company’s stock had a trading volume of 5,999 shares, compared to its average volume of 46,061. Tenet Fintech Group has a 12-month low of $0.01 and a 12-month high of $0.11. The firm has a 50 day moving average price of $0.05 and a 200-day moving average price of $0.05. The stock has a market capitalization of $14.66 million, a P/E ratio of -0.67 and a beta of 1.25.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 9.61, a current ratio of 0.97 and a quick ratio of 0.97.

Tenet Fintech Group Inc, through its subsidiaries, provides various analytics and AI-based services to small-and-medium businesses and financial institutions. It offers Business Hub, a global ecosystem where analytics and AI are used to create opportunities and facilitate B2B transactions among its members. The company was formerly known as Peak Fintech Group Inc and changed its name to Tenet Fintech Group Inc in November 2021. Tenet Fintech Group Inc was incorporated in 2008 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.
